How did this become its own subgenre? It's oddly specific.
Genres of isekai:
  1. Villainess
  2. Edgelord monster MC powertrip where they brutalize everyone
  3. I became (insert creature and/or object) and it had no effect on the plot
  4. I have (insert seemingly useless power) which is actually the best power of them all
  5. I became a noble and fixed my country with cheat skills/perfect self
  6. MC gets spawned in a dungeon and has to level up and choose between options (always chooses the right option) to get out
  7. MC is/gets a dungeon and has to protect/manage it
  8. MC is overpowered but wants to live a normal life (everyone in the world is an intolerant warmonger)
  9. MC has a mundane power slice of life
  10. MC is super weak for like 3 seconds and then gets some cheat skill from a goddess or a dragon or whatever, and sometimes also befriends them
  11. MC has earth technology which allows them to win every time
  12. The world is a game MC played so they know all of the speedrunner minmax strats
  13. Obligatory harem story where MC collects waifus
Mix and match these for literally every isekai of the last 20 years

Even my favorite isekai bookworm is a combination of 5 and 11, what sets it apart is mostly execution

Overlord is 2 and 12
Slime is 3, 8 and 10
You get the gist
